CVE-2026-40372: CWE-347: Improper Verification of Cryptographic Signature in Microsoft ASP.NET Core 10.0
Improper verification of cryptographic signature in ASP.NET Core allows an unauthorized attacker to elevate privileges over a network.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
This vulnerability (CVE-2026-40372) affects Microsoft ASP.NET Core 10.0 and is categorized under CWE-347, which pertains to improper verification of cryptographic signatures. Due to this flaw, an attacker can bypass signature verification mechanisms, enabling privilege escalation remotely. The vulnerability is remotely exploitable with no privileges or user interaction required, and it impacts confidentiality and integrity with no impact on availability. Microsoft has published an official fix to remediate the issue.
Potential Impact
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ability allows an attacker to elevate privileges over the network, potentially gaining unauthorized access to sensitive data or functionality within ASP.NET Core 10.0 applications. The impact is critical, affecting confidentiality and integrity of the system. There are currently no known exploits in the wild.
Mitigation Recommendations
An official fix is available from Microsoft. Users and administrators of ASP.NET Core 10.0 should apply the vendor-provided patch as soon as possible. Refer to the Microsoft advisory at https://msrc.microsoft.com/update-guide/vulnerability/CVE-2026-40372 for detailed remediation instructions.
